Why To Keep Your Inclusive Sourcing Efforts In 2025
What we are currently experiencing with regard to Diversity, Equality & Inclusion (DEI) is quite disturbing. I feel I need to highlight why DEI particularly in the supply chain, is still a competitive advantage and not just a box-ticking exercise.
- Innovation – diverse suppliers bring fresh perspectives & driving creative solutions
- Sustainability – diverse suppliers often bring eco-friendly practices and products
- Economic Empowerment – Working with diverse businesses fosters global economic growth
- Enhanced Resilience – Inclusive supply chains and diverse owned businesses adapt better to worldwide challenges
- Market Expansion – Engaging diverse suppliers opens doors to new markets and creates more competition
- Risk Mitigation – A diverse supplier base reduces dependency on single sources
- Social Impact – Inclusive sourcing promotes equity and aligns with ESG goals
We know that by maintaining inclusive sourcing practices, companies not only drive innovation and boost resilience but also contribute to a more sustainable, equitable world. That’s why inclusive sourcing practices are still a strategic imperative for long-term success for any company.
